OBJECTIVE: We aimed to investigate the range of fetal NT-proBNP values in normal pregnancy between 20 and 34 weeks of gestation. METHOD: NT-proBNP was measured in 56 fetal blood samples. RESULTS: Mean (+ or - 2 SD) NT-proBNP concentration was 1998 (242-3754) ng/L; a significant decline occurred with advancing gestational age (p=0.012). CONCLUSIONS: Gestational age has to be taken in to consideration in the assessment of NT-proBNP. Our data may be used as reference values in fetal and neonatal medicine.
